A KERedirect Untrusted Pointer Dereference Privilege Escalation vulnerability in Trend Micro Antivirus for Mac (Consumer) 7.0 (2017) and above could allow a local attacker to escalate privileges on. Rated high severity (CVSS 7.8), this vulnerability is low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.

A ctl_set KERedirect Untrusted Pointer Dereference Privilege Escalation vulnerability in Trend Micro Antivirus for Mac (Consumer) 7.0 (2017) and above could allow a local attacker to escalate. Rated high severity (CVSS 7.8), this vulnerability is low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
A UrlfWTPPagePtr KERedirect Use-After-Free Privilege Escalation vulnerability in Trend Micro Antivirus for Mac (Consumer) 7.0 (2017) and above could allow a local attacker to escalate privileges on. Rated high severity (CVSS 7.8), this vulnerability is low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
